The Federal Aviation Administration published an airworthiness directive designated as AD 2022-03-14 on February 14, 2022. This regulatory action applies to Airbus SAS airplanes, with specific relevance noted for the Airbus A350 family of aircraft. The directive is scheduled to become effective on March 21, 2022. This notice serves as an official update regarding airworthiness standards for these specific aircraft models.
